I am seeing signs of another Google search algorithm ranking update touching down over the past couple of days, which is why I am naming it the Google I/O Search Algorithm Ranking Update. This is not confirmed by Google but both SEO chatter and the automated tracking tools all show signs of an update.
Gary Illyes from Google said that having invalid schema markup does not hurt your rankings or your site. He said the worse case, if Google cannot parse the markup, it won’t use it.
Google Bard had a bunch of updates roll out at Google I/O, which I did not cover the other day, because, well, there was a lot of core search I had to cover. Google removed the waitlist for Bard, and added Google Search, Maps, Lens, and other search-related features to the AI generative service.
Ginny Marvin, Google’s Ads Liaison, posted on Twitter the other day saying, “The deadline is not changing,” when asked about a rumor that the GA4 deadline was being pushed off. That rumor is not true she said.
Several years ago, Google Search added a search feature to help you pronounce words. Google Search has now added to that feature a way to practice your pronunciation directly in the search results.
